    Selfridges is an department store that was founded in 1909 by Harry Gordon Selfridge, is a chain of department stores. The Oxford Street location in London, England, is famous for its windows and other exhibits. The company's founder was adamant about making shopping a leisure activity and he designed a unique shopping experience for his customers.

    Decathlon

    Decathlon is the largest retailer of sports goods in the world. It oversees all aspects of research, design production, logistics and production in-house. It also collaborates with global suppliers and sells directly to customers through big-box Decathlon stores. This vertical integration lets Decathlon eliminate middlemen and keep prices low. Decathlon offers an in-house brand that caters to every sport, including Nabaji for swimming, Quechua for hiking/trekking, Kalenji for running, Wedze for downhill skiing, Oroks for ice hockey and Domyos for fitness.

    These lower prices make sports more accessible to more people. However they don't sacrifice performance or quality. Rather, they improve the quality of products through innovation and technology.     Cos

    Cos is the flagship product of H&M Group in a tier that includes & Other Stories, Afound, Arket, Cheap Monday, and Monki. It launched in 2007 and now has 264 stores around the world. It also sells on internet.
